Is it true what was mentioned, that Asiya, Maryam, Sarah, and Hagar were present at the birth of the Prophet, peace and blessings be upon him, and that he will marry them in Paradise, knowing that Sarah and Hagar are in the position of his grandmothers?
Narrations mention signs that accompanied the Prophet's pregnancy, such as animals speaking, the veiling of soothsayers, and the overturning of kings' beds.
His mother, Aminah, narrated that she saw wondrous visions and events during her pregnancy and childbirth, and spoke of women appearing around her. However, these narrations are not authentic or based on evidence.
As for the claim that the Prophet, peace and blessings be upon him, will marry Asiya, Mary, Sarah, and Hagar in Paradise, it is false, as Sarah and Hagar are the wives of Abraham, peace be upon him, in Paradise.
No is authentic regarding the Prophet's marriage in Paradise to Mary, Kulthum, and Asiya.
